A particular consciousness program specializing in Child Rights, Health, and Nutrition was organized at PM Shri Government Senior Secondary School, Prothrapur on tenth September 2025. The initiative aimed to teach college students on vital points affecting their well being, security, and total well-being.
The first session of this system featured Ms. V. Jyotimani, ANM, who spoke to the scholars about adolescence and points associated to menstrual hygiene. Ms. Nilofar Bano, Call Operator at CHL, supplied info on necessary helplines together with Child Help Line (1098), Women Helpline (181), and Senior Citizen Helpline (14567). She inspired youngsters to talk out towards violence and use these toll-free numbers to report any incidents.
During the second session, Ms. Hemlatha, Gender Specialist at SHEW, addressed gender points and confused the significance of equality amongst youngsters.
Dr. Nitu Sindhu, State Mission Coordinator at SHEW, highlighted the importance of the HPV vaccine in stopping cervical most cancers, genital warts, and different cancers in each women and men. She additionally emphasised the dietary advantages of superfoods corresponding to moringa and jackfruit in combating malnutrition amongst adolescents.
The session concluded with Ms. Jyoti, SI, PS Pahargaon, who spoke in regards to the risks of drug abuse and motivated college students to concentrate on their research for a brighter future.
The program was well-received by the scholars, who actively participated and engaged with the audio system all through the classes. (Story Based on PR)
